I have a pair of ocellaris clowns and I introduced a RBTA around a week ago, three days later, my female clown started hosting it. Since then, every time the male clown approaches the anemone, the female clown goes after it to pick him.

Is this a normal behavior? At night, the male clown sleeps next to the anemone with the female clown.
 
Yes this is normal behavior. The female is just keeping her dominance, letting the male know that it is her territory first.

Anytime I have moved a mature pair of clowns into a different tank there always seems to be a little bullying on the part of the female. Weather they are hosting and anemone or a clay pot, the female will kick the male out until she gets settled. Usually she will get comfortable within 1-3 weeks.
 
As stated above this is pretty normal. Eventually she will let the little guy join her. She just needs to prove a point first.
